Regan and Abby: “Paid parental leave is critical to families”

Regan and Abby talked about a hot topic on their Tuesday morning show this week: paid parental leave. Congress is possibly looking at legislation to mandate 12 weeks of paid leave and both Regan and Abby are fierce advocates of paid parental leave.

The women are both working mothers and run businesses and non-profits. Abby’s non-profit, And Then There Were None, offers employees 12 weeks of paid maternity leave following a birth or adoption and offers paid leave for miscarriages as well. This should be the norm, not the exception.
